Hessequa Municipality: 2026 Graduate Internship Opportunities

Hessequa Municipality Internship Opportunity 2026

Hessequa Municipality is inviting South African TVET N6 graduates and university graduates to join its National Diploma and Graduate Internship Programme for 2026. The programme is a chance to get real work experience in a local government setting and earn a stipend while you learn on the job.

Key Details

  • Application deadline: 20 February 2026
  • Locations: Heidelberg, Riversdale, Albertinia or Stilbaai, all in the Western Cape, South Africa

About Hessequa Municipality

Hessequa is a local municipality that serves communities around Heidelberg, Riversdale, Albertinia and Stilbaai. The council focuses on building skills, creating jobs for young people and giving equal chances to everyone.

The Internship Programme

The programme gives you hands‑on training in a real office or field setting. You can work between 3 and 18 months, depending on your area of study and what the municipality needs.

Fields of Study

  • Electrical Engineering
  • Civil Engineering
  • Mechanical Engineering
  • Office Management
  • Human Resources
  • Finance and Accounting
  • Tourism

TVET N6 Internship

  • For students who have finished a National Certificate N6
  • Goal: help you earn a National Diploma
  • Stipend: R4 000 per month

Graduate Internship

  • For recent university graduates in South Africa
  • Stipend: R6 500 per month

People who live in the Hessequa region get priority.

Who Can Apply?

  • Must have finished N6 or hold a university degree
  • Must be a South African citizen
  • Ready to work at one of the municipal sites listed above
  • Must fill out a complete application form and send all required documents

The municipality is an equal opportunity employer and welcomes applicants with disabilities and from previously disadvantaged groups.
